    What Makes Tolperisone Hydrochloride Distinct?

    Most older muscle relaxants act through heavy sedation, hitting the entire central nervous system and leaving you feeling foggy or sleepy for hours. There’s a delicate balance between taming spasms and preserving clear-headedness. Tolperisone Hydrochloride takes a different approach, working mainly at the spinal and supraspinal level. It aims at the nerve cells responsible for ‘turning on’ muscle tension but also affects blood flow, which adds another layer of relief during those tight, painful spells.

    Another hallmark is the relatively low risk of dependency or abuse. Tales of misuse and withdrawal are far rarer here than with some older muscle relaxants or painkillers that have flooded hospitals and clinics over the years. For people recovering from injury, surgery, or an illness with muscle spasticity, this peace of mind matters almost as much as the relief itself.

    Direct comparison with central acting muscle relaxants like baclofen or tizanidine reveals differences that matter in real life. While those drugs may work through repressing neurotransmitter release more broadly, Tolperisone Hydrochloride tries to fine-tune the traffic within nerve pathways that regulate muscle tone. Reports from practicing neurologists and rehabilitation specialists find patients have better tolerance, less drowsiness, and fewer incidents of confusion or falling asleep in the middle of a conversation.

    Comparisons with Other Muscle Relaxants

    Muscle relaxants come in a wide range, from benzodiazepines like diazepam and clonazepam to more specialized agents, including baclofen, tizanidine, cyclobenzaprine, and carisoprodol. Many of these work by influencing neurotransmitters such as GABA, and they’re notorious for their strong sedation profiles and, at times, a rough withdrawal phase. For elderly patients or anyone juggling multiple medications, these risks grow higher—confusion, dizziness, and risk of falls can quickly turn muscle relief into a cascade of side effects.

    Tolperisone Hydrochloride stands out for its comparatively favorable safety margin, lighter sedation effect, and reduced risk of interactions with heart medications, blood pressure drugs, and antiepileptics. People handling jobs, school schedules, or active rehabilitation find this difference important, and it allows them to keep more daily independence. It isn’t about an imaginary cure-all, but about honest, steady improvement on what came before.

    Looking at the Science: Clinical Experience and Real-World Reports

    Clinicians and researchers have monitored Tolperisone Hydrochloride’s performance over decades, not only in controlled trials but in real-world use. Recent literature reviews highlight its capacity to decrease tone in conditions like post-stroke spasticity and multiple sclerosis with fewer side effects. A typical story comes from outpatient settings, where people with stroke-related rigidity discover they can perform rehab exercises more comfortably. Older studies out of Europe, especially from Germany and Hungary, showed that patients tolerated Tolperisone Hydrochloride well even during long-term therapy. The most common side effects are mild, with occasional reports of headache or gastrointestinal disturbance, but nothing like the sedation and muscle weakness seen with more traditional options.

    For people with chronic pain linked to myofascial or neuropathic sources, physicians sometimes add Tolperisone Hydrochloride to broader regimens. The flexibility in dose adjustment and the lower chance of withdrawal symptoms support its use as a long-term muscle relaxant. Concerns about liver or kidney function still require thoughtful oversight, but the drug’s track record with careful dosing earns trust in the medical community.
